Get funded! English for Grant Writing
Winning research funding is a competitive business. With much funding now targeted at international cooperation, the ability to write effectively and convincingly in English is a requirement of any researcher. This workshop is designed to help those who do not have English as their native language improve their ability to write research proposals especially for European funding programmes.
Content and Aim of the Workshop
Participants will learn how to identify good models and develop effective writing strategies to target an interdisciplinary readership and put their message across in English. Participants will be introduced to the 'grammar-free' portfolio approach to developing their writing skills, followed by a 'hands-on' practice session.

ReMaT Workshop for Early-Stage-Researchers
Research Management Training in Brussels, Belgium
The ReMaT Workshop Research management training for early-stage researchers - will take place in Brussels on 16th and 17th April 2012. The workshop is designed for early-stage researchers in engineering and natural sciences, particularly PhD candidates from the 2nd year onwards. The idea of European networking is very much embedded in the concept, and we encourage participation from many different countries at the workshop.
ReMaT is an interactive, intensive workshop providing an introduction to research management. It involves three international trainers and is held in English. The modules of the workshop cover exploitation of knowledge and entrepreneurship, acquisition of grants, intellectual property rights and the management of interdisciplinary projects. They are delivered in such a way that it challenges participants to consider different perspectives on how they might use their PhD education in a variety of career paths, and convince others to hire them.
